Green walls, also known as living walls or vertical gardens, are structures that incorporate living plants into the design of a wall or other vertical surface. They transform plain surfaces into lush living artworks. By combining modular planting systems with diverse greenery such as succulents, ferns, and flowering varieties, green walls provide year-round beauty, enhanced air quality, and dynamic focal points that meld nature with architecture.

Living Artworks

Green walls transform ordinary vertical surfaces into dynamic living artworks that evolve with the seasons. The combination of various plant species creates visual depth and interest.

Beyond their beauty, green walls provide functional benefits including improved air quality, temperature regulation, and noise reduction—making them both aesthetic and practical additions to any outdoor space.
